The late Milt Wolfe was an enthusiastic life member of Protection Engine Company No. 1 in the Village
of Fishkill. His support and enthusiasm for the volunteer fire service was always in evidence. Milt
serve actively in several capacities including line and civil offices and as a Fire Policeman. His enthusiasm
continued with his late son, George, who rose through the ranks to become Chief of the Department
and on to his grandson, Richard “Radar” Wolfe who has served as a chief officer. The scholarship
award was named in Milt’s honor shortly after his passing in 1979. It has been awarded to a deserving
student every year an application was rendered since then.
Eligibility
A student of the John Jay High School (WCS).
Be committed to continuing your education after graduation from high school.
Be a member of a Fire Department or EMS Service. (or number 4 below)
Be a son, daughter, or ward of a member of a Fire Department or EMS Service in the area served by
John Jay High School.
Must NOT have a record of repetitive violations of the schools attendance policy, disciplinary actions
or substance abuse.
Application must be received by the Fishkill Exempt Firemen’s Benevolent Association by May 15th of the year in which scholarship will be awarded.
Selection Process
The governing board of the Fishkill Exempt Firemen’s Benevolent Association shall make the ultimate
determination of the winner of this scholarship. The winner of the scholarship is to attend a formal
presentation of the award for administrative and photographic opportunity purposes as established by
the governing board.
Fishkill Little League Team Sponsored by Protection Engine Company
For over 25 years, Protection Engine Company has supported the Fishkill Little League by sponsoring a team. The Company has sponsored, boy’s Senior League Teams, boy’s Little League Teams and for the last few years proudly sponsored a girl’s Softball Team. Best of luck for a great season!!!
